CHSA Members Excelled In 2023

A Manufacturing members achieved over 92% compliance, and 99.8% of product stocked by CHSA distributors met CHSA standards

Cleaning & Hygiene Suppliers Association (CHSA) members achieved high levels of compliance to the relevant Accreditation Scheme standard in 2023.

The exceptional compliance offers buyers and users of cleaning and hygiene products the guarantee they need: ‘what’s on the box is what’s in the box’.


Trench Bowling Club – The Best Kept Green In Shropshire 2023 – Uses A Microbial Programme From OAS

Trench Bowling Club with their pitch cut at 6.5mm

Trench Bowling Club in Telford has recently celebrated its 100th anniversary and to top off this special year, has been judged The Best Kept Green in Shropshire 2023. The club has 45 playing members and competes in the Mid‑Shropshire Bowling Leagues.

Johnsons Sports Seed To Launch New Sustainable Seed Solutions At BTME 2024

DLF at Prestwick Golf Clubhouse

Following another year of extensive trials and research, Johnsons Sports Seed return to BTME with a bolstered fine turf portfolio – including two brand new mixtures and five new formulations for 2024. Created to address two of the biggest issues currently facing the industry, drought tolerance and disease resistance, visitors can find out more about new Johnsons J Sustain‑Fairway, J Ultrafine Rye 100 and more by stopping by stand 126 in January.
